Video Poker has in common quite a few schemes with slots too. For instance, you always want to gamble the maximum coins on every hand. Once you at last do win the grand prize it tends to profit. Hitting the big prize with only fifty percent of the biggest wager is surely to cramp one’s style. If you are betting on at a dollar game and can’t commit to bet with the maximum, switch to a 25 cent machine and wager with max coins there. On a dollar machine 75 cents isn’t the same as $.75 on a quarter machine.
Also, like slot machines, Video Poker is decidedly random. Cards and new cards are allotted numbers. When the video poker game is is always running through these numbers several thousand per second, when you hit deal or draw it stops on a number and deals out the card assigned to that number. This banishes the illusion that a machine might become ‘ready’ to get a jackpot or that immediately before landing on a big hand it could tighten up. Every hand is just as likely as every other to win.
